A new Earls is opening in downtown Toronto & it has a rooftop patio

Earls has become a very popular restaurant in Toronto over the years known for its yummy drinks, amazing happy hour deals and good vibes! The city is welcoming a brand new location on King West, set to open in June and it has some features unlike any other location.

The new Toronto Earls location is right in the heart of one of the city’s most popular neighbourhoods, King Street West.

According to Earls, the restaurant is opening its doors on June 28th, 2024.

The new spot is “the most unique one yet, providing a mix of classic design elements and brand-new features that will stun the King West community.”

There are three large outdoor patios, including a rooftop oasis that is “a first for the King West strip.”

Earls also mentioned that “unlike other Earls locations, a retro Earls sign welcomes guests to King West with old-school charm, boasting exposed brick, wood floors, and textured walls adorned with local art, creating an inviting atmosphere that exudes warmth and character.”

Visitors can enjoy daily rituals such as half-price bottles of wine on Tuesdays and Wednesdays, but the the King West location will also feature unique offerings that no other Earls in the city will have such as weekly Brunch Parties and a Thursday night DJ!

Earls King West Toronto

When: Opening June 28th, 2024
Where: 603 King St W
